How Is the Mental Health of the French Population Changing During the COVID-19 Pandemic? – Results from Wave 34 of the CoviPrev Survey

Key Findings from Wave 34 (May 9–16, 2022)

  • 81% of French people report having a positive outlook on life in general [Relatively low level, down 4 points from pre-pandemic levels, downward trend compared to the previous wave]

  • 15% of French people show signs of depression [High level, +5 points compared to pre-pandemic levels, stable trend compared to the previous wave]

  • 25% of French people show signs of anxiety [Very high level, +12 points compared to pre-pandemic levels, stable trend compared to the previous wave]

  • 67% of French people report sleep problems over the past 8 days [Very high level, +18 points compared to pre-pandemic levels, stable trend compared to the previous wave]

  • 11% of French people have had suicidal thoughts over the past year [High level, +7 points compared to pre-pandemic levels, stable trend compared to the previous wave]
